How Our Sewage Water Removal Process Works

When sewage water invades your property, every minute counts. Our team is equipped to respond quickly, with a process that’s designed to reduce damage and restore your home to its original condition. We’ll work with you to identify the source of the issue and develop a customized plan to address it.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team arrives within 60 minutes to assess the situation and contain the affected area, preventing further damage and potential health risks.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ract sewage water and prevent it from spreading.

Step 2: Sewage Water Extraction

We use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ract sewage water from your property, removing it safely and efficiently. Our technicians will work to identify and address the root cause of the issue.

Step 3: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

We use EPA-registered disinfectants to sanitize and disinfect your property, removing any remaining sewage bacteria and odors. Our goal is to leave your home smelling fresh and clean.

Step 4: Drying and Restoration

We use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ry your property, ensuring that it’s safe and dry within 3-5 days. Our team will work to restore your home to its original condition, including any necessary repairs or renovations.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ification

We conduct a final inspection to ensure that your property is safe and free from any remaining sewage-related hazards. Our team will provide you with a certificate of completion, verifying that your property has been properly restored.

Sewage Water Removal Cost in South Riding, VA

The cost of sewage water removal can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in South Riding, VA.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ate after assessing your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the severity of the issue.
Sewage Water Extraction $1,000 – $5,000 The amount of sewage water and the equipment required.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of disinfectant used.
Drying and Restoration $2,000 – $10,000 The size of the affected area and the extent of the damage.
Final Inspection and Certification $200 – $1,000 The complexity of the restoration process.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ates to help you understand the cost of our services.
